在Ubuntu 9.04上最新的Mono + MonoDevelop设置是什么?

Sam*_*ang 5 c# installation mono monodevelop ubuntu-9.04

我开始在笔记本电脑上使用Ubuntu 9.04.我真正想要的是能够在Ubuntu上编写我的C#项目,包括单元测试.任何人都可以指导我如何设置它?

Mik*_*son 6

除了Matthew建议的基本软件包之外,您还需要该monodevelop-nunit软件包,它允许您在IDE中运行和调试单元测试.对于调试器,您需要monodevelop-debugger-mdb.您可能还需要monodevelop-versioncontrolSVN支持,mono-xsp2运行ASP.NET应用程序和monodoc-browserdocs查看器.

也许你最好只安装MonoDevelop软件包提供的所有软件包 - 我相信Ubuntu软件包管理器可以通过它的GUI轻松完成.

请注意,Ubuntu将Mono拆分为许多小包,所以如果缺少某些东西,请使用该apt-file工具或类似工具找到您需要安装的软件包.

Ubuntu还没有Mono 2.4软件包; 如果您需要100%最新的软件包,最好的办法是使用openSUSE.现在在Ubuntu上获得2.4的唯一方法是从源代码构建 - 如果你决定这样做,请阅读如何不首先打破Mono安装.


Mat*_*hen 0

编辑:添加了单开发

我使用 Ubuntu 8.04,但你真正需要设置什么?正在做(如果你还没有):

sudo apt-get install monodevelop nunit mono-devel

应该给你你需要的东西。并且有很多针对 monodevelop (例如http://monodevelop.com/Documentation/Creating_A_Simple_Solution)和 NUnit (例如http://www.nunit.org/index.php?p=quickStart&r=2.4.8)的教程